Krabi is noted as one of the most relaxing places to be in Thailand. It is a popular tourist destination sought after by those who love beautiful beaches and stunning natural scenery. It is located within the province of Krabi, which is in Southern Thailand. This region is one of the fastest growing tourist spots in this part of Thailand and has plenty to offer its guests including incredible diving spots.


Scuba diving is one of many activities that can be enjoyed in Krabi, Thailand. It is also considered as one of the best dive destinations in the country because of the variety of the dive sites that you can find.

From wall dives, caves, caverns, swim throughs, and drop-offs, there are plenty of exhilarating dive sites that are suited for expert divers. But even if you are a beginner, there are enough options available to enjoy your diving experience.

The average water temperature in Krabi is also part of the reason why it is popular as a dive destination. The average water temperature ranges from 24 to 32 degrees Celsius.

These dive sites are moderate but there are certain times of the year when the currents are strong. You can also expect great water visibility ranging from 10 to 30 meter in depth, depending on the time of year.

The dive sites in Krabi offer a wide variety of marine life. It is home to 80 coral species and up to 200 fish species.


krabi diving

Ao Nang Local Islands

If you are seeking diversity in your diving experience, the Ao Nang islands are a great destination in Krabi. This dive site consists of several rock islets that offer a variety of diving locations to suit all types of divers. Just like the dive sites available here, the marine life is also widely varied that includes hawksbill turtles, leopard sharks, groupers, barracudas, and schools of reef fish. The reef itself also boasts of vibrant colors that will make your dive memorable.

Bida Nai

While this dive site is a bit small, it is no less impressive. This dive site in Krabi offers swim throughs that are home to many fish species including ghost pipefish, scorpion fish, and nudibranch. If you care to explore deeper into the reef, you can also stumble upon large barrel sponges and sea whips. Make sure to explore the sandy areas and bottom of the rocks to find these marine species.

Bida Nok

For all dive and live board enthusiasts in Krabi, this is one of their favorite sites. There is a good reason for this – Bida Nok consists of vertical walls that are filled with colorful corals. You will find more colorful corals the deeper you go underwater. Aside from these corals, you will find an abundance of shelf overhangs, crevices, and recesses that serve as home to a variety of marine species. This is the best dive site to go to when you want to see angelfishes, butterfly fishes, parrotfishes, wrasse, and moray eels.

King Cruiser Wreck

This shipwreck is another famous dive site in Krabi. This ship sank in 1997 when it collided with the Anemone Reef. Today, the shipwreck sits close to the reef in an upright position. The shallowest portion of the shipwreck is at 12 meters at the captain’s cabin. It has transformed into an artificial reef that is home to schooling fish and lionfish. Exploring the inside of the shipwreck is not allowed, though.

Need scuba gear?

Check out our gear reviews


Krabi has excellent diving conditions all year round. This can be attributed to its popularity. However, it does have a monsoon season, which must be avoided for those who want to maximize their diving trip. Monsoon season takes place in May to November.

For optimal diving conditions, you must book your diving trip from January to March. This will ensure maximum visibility underwater so you can make the most of each dive.


By Air:

The Krabi International Airport is the closest airport to fly to if you want to go to Krabi. There are several international and domestic flights that fly to this airport on a daily basis, mostly from Thai Airways and Bangkok Airways. There are also flights from Air Asia from Bangkok and Kuala Lumpur.

By Land:

There are plenty of options to travel to Krabi by land. The first option is via car as you will find many car rental operators in Thailand. You can also ride a taxi to get to Krabi and you must travel via Highway 4.

Riding a bus is another option for getting to Krabi by land. You can go to Bangkok’s Southern Terminal to find a bus that is headed for Krabi for less than 500 Baht. There are also VIP buses that offer a more comfortable ride. The bus ride will take about 10 hours from Bangkok.

Finally, you can travel via train to Krabi. The nearest stations are located at Surat Thani and Trang.



Tourism is one of the main industries that support Krabi’s local economy. For those who visit Krabi, you will be spoiled for options as there are plenty of things to see or do here.

For instance, there are several national parks within the province. Among the most visited national parks are the Ko Lanta National Park, Khao Phanom Bencha National Park, and Hat Nopparat Thara – Mu Ko Phi Phi National Park. There are also about 80 smaller islands that make up the province.

Each of these islands is worth visiting and exploring as they have unique attractions on their own. These islands are recommended for scuba diving, snorkeling, yachting, kayaking, sailing, and swimming. In fact, Krabi has some of the most beautiful beaches you will find in Thailand.

There are plenty of notable destinations in Krabi for those seeking an adventurous holiday. At Ban Ao Luek, you will find many caves to explore. If you want a peaceful and quiet escape, you can go to either Ko Lanta or Ko Jum. And for those seeking an eco-tourism experience in Krabi, Ko Por is the best destination for that.



Save on your hotel -

Ever heard of PADI Travel? Yep, you can now book your dives and rooms with the biggest name in scuba diving! Trust me, you want to book you dream dive trip with the most trusted name in the industry! 

Click the button to start browsing dive resorts and destinations. 


Krabi is a resort town belonging to the province of Krabi. It is located on the western coast of Southern Thailand. The Krabi River is located here and is connected to the Phang Nga Bay, which is one of the most popular attractions in this part of Thailand.

The town has a population of about 53,000 (as of 2010) and is visited by millions of tourists annually. There are also many expats in Krabi.

This coastal town borders the Andaman Sea and is about 814 kilometers from Bangkok. The town covers a total land area of 4,708 square kilometers.

It boasts of a mountainous landscape with a mixture of highlands and plains. As there are many islands that form the province, it means plenty of diving opportunities for those who are enthusiasts.

Time zone:

Calling code:

Closest airport:

220-240 V


“Hello” in Thai:
Sawasdee (sah-wah-dee)